if (self.CavalryLogger) { CavalryLogger.start_js(["BsoEr"]); } __d("MStoriesStratcomEvents",[],(function(a,b,c,d,e,f){"use strict";a={DELETE_BUCKET:"fb:stories:mobile:story:viewer:story:deleted",DELETE_THREAD:"fb:stories:mobile:story:viewer:delete:thread",MUTE_BUCKET:"fb:stories:mobile:story:viewer:story:muted",MEDIA_PAUSE:"m:stories:thread:media:pause",MEDIA_PAUSE_WITH_COVER:"m:stories:thread:media:pause:with:cover",MEDIA_PLAY:"m:stories:thread:media:play",NEXT_BUCKET:"fb:stories:mobile:story:viewer:nextBucket",NEXT_CARD:"fb:stories:mobile:story:viewer:nextCard",CARD_CHANGED_BY_VIEWER_SHEET:"fb:stories:mobile:story:viewer:card:changed:by:viewer:sheet",PREV_BUCKET:"fb:stories:mobile:story:viewer:prevBucket",CLICK_STORY_IN_VIEWER_SHEET:"fb:stories:mobile:story:viewer:click:story:in:viewer:sheet",THREAD_MODAL_HIDE:"m:stories:card:modal:hide",VIDEO_PLAY:"m:video:player:play",VIDEO_PLAYING:"m:video:player:playing",VIEWER_SHEET_HIDE:"m-stories-viewer-sheet-hide",VIEWER_SHEET_HIDDEN:"m-stories-viewer-sheet-hidden",VIEWER_SHEET_OPEN:"m-stories-viewer-sheet-open",VIEWER_SHEET_IMAGE_CHANGED_BY_SCROLLING:"m-stories-viewer-sheet-image-changed-by-scrolling",VIEWER_SHEET_NATIVE_TEMPLATE_CHANGED_BY_SCROLLING:"m-stories-viewer-sheet-native-template-changed-by-scrolling",PRODUCTION_PREVIEW_CONTROLS_HIDE:"m:stories:production:preview-controls:hide",PRODUCTION_PREVIEW_CONTROLS_SHOW:"m:stories:production:preview-controls:show",PRODUCTION_TEXT_CONTROLS_HIDE:"m:stories:production:text-controls:hide",PRODUCTION_TEXT_CONTROLS_SHOW:"m:stories:production:text-controls:show",PRODUCTION_TEXT_OVERLAY_REMOVE:"m:stories:production:text-overlay:remove",PRODUCTION_TEXT_OVERLAY_FOCUS:"m:stories:production:text-overlay:focus",SWIPE_LEFT:"m:stories:swipe:left",SWIPE_RIGHT:"m:stories:swipe:right",SWIPE_DOWN:"m:stories:swipe:down",SWIPE_UP:"m:stories:swipe:up",SWIPE_REPLY:"fb:stories:mobile:story:viewer:swipe:reply",TOAST_SHOWING:"m:stories:toast:showing",TOAST_HIDING:"m:stories:toast:hiding",UPLOAD_FAILED:"m:stories:upload:failed",UPLOAD_SUCCESS:"m:stories:upload:success",OVERLAY_INTERACTION_PAUSE:"m:stories:overlay-interaction:pause",OVERLAY_INTERACTION_PLAY:"m:stories:overlay-interaction:play",SET_BUCKET_IDS_USE_FOR_TESTING_ONLY:"m:stories:set-bucket-ids-use-for-testing-only"};e.exports=a}),null); __d("MStoriesDOMUtils",["Bootloader","DOM"],(function(a,b,c,d,e,f){"use strict";__p&&__p();a={find:function(a,c,d){a=b("DOM").scry(a,c,d);if(a.length===0){b("Bootloader").loadModules(["FBLogger"],function(a){a("fbstories").mustfix("Failed to load dom element with tag %s and sigil %s",c,d||"")},"MStoriesDOMUtils");return null}return a[0]}};e.exports=a}),null); __d("MStoriesGating",["MFBStoriesGatingConfig","gkx","qex"],(function(a,b,c,d,e,f){"use strict";a={genShouldShowTextOverlays:function(){return b("MFBStoriesGatingConfig").enableTextOverlayProduction},genShouldShowStoriesEffects:function(){return b("gkx")("676799")},shouldShowOptimisticPreviews:function(){return b("gkx")("676800")},shouldShowNTViewerSheet:function(){return b("qex")._("863251")}};e.exports=a}),null); __d("MArrays",[],(function(a,b,c,d,e,f){"use strict";e.exports={findPrefix:function(a,b){for(var c=0;c0)return;this._listeners=[b("Stratcom").listen(j,null,function(){if(!b("MStoriesTrayInfo").getTrayNeedsRefresh())return;b("Bootloader").loadModules(["MStoriesTrayUtils"],function(b){b.refreshTray(),b.refreshFeedUnitsWithURIs(a._feedUnitURIs)},"MStoriesTrayAsync")}),b("Stratcom").listen("click","m-stories-tray-archive-link",this._openArchive),b("Stratcom").listen("click","m-stories-tray-pog-container",function(b){a._openPOG(b)}),b("Stratcom").listen("keypress","m-stories-tray-pog-container",function(b){var c=b.getSpecialKey();(c==="return"||c==="space")&&(b.prevent(),a._openPOG(b))}),b("Stratcom").listen(b("MStoriesStratcomEvents").UPLOAD_SUCCESS,null,function(a){a=a.getData()||{};i&&i.handleUploadSuccess(a.newThreadID,a.optimisticThreadID)})];b("MStoriesHideHeaderListener").setup();i&&i.initializeOnTrayLoad();b("MStoriesProductionTrayUtils").updateProductionPog();b("Run").onLeave(function(){a._destroy()})},_openArchive:function(a){a=a.getNode("m-stories-tray-archive-link");if(a!=null){var c=a.getAttribute("data-href");c&&window.setTimeout(function(){b("MPageController").load(c,{hideLoadingIndicator:!1})})}},_openPOG:function(a){__p&&__p();var c=this,d=a.getNode("m-stories-tray-pog-container");if(this._currentItemLoading){if(this._currentItemLoading===d)return;this._setLoadingStateHidden(this._currentItemLoading,!0)}if(!d)return;d.id==="m-stories-owner-bucket"?b("Bootloader").loadModules(["MStoriesProductionTrayAsync"],function(a){if(!d)return;if(a.handleFailedAddToStoryPogSelected())return;c._openViewer(d)},"MStoriesTrayAsync"):this._openViewer(d)},_setLoadingStateHidden:function(a,c){__p&&__p();var d=b("MFBStoriesGatingConfig").trayType,e=c?b("CSS").removeClass:b("CSS").addClass;switch(d){case"circular":e(a,"loading");break;case"fblite_with_profile_pog":e(a,"_6pvo");break;case"nine_by_sixteen":case"mobile_three_by_one":a=b("MStoriesDOMUtils").find(a,"div","m-stories-tray-pog");if(a){if(c&&a.id==="m-stories-owner-bucket-pog")return;d==="nine_by_sixteen"?e(a,"loading"):e(a,"_1zpf")}break}},_openViewer:function(a){__p&&__p();this._currentItemLoading=a;var c=b("MFBStoriesGatingConfig").trayType;c=c!=="circular";b("QuickPerformanceLogger").markerEnd(13238313,4);b("QuickPerformanceLogger").markerStart(13238313);if(!c){c=b("MStoriesDOMUtils").find(a,"i","m-stories-tray-pog-picture");c!==null&&b("DOM").insertAfter(c,this._spinner)}var d=a.getAttribute("data-href");b("MStoriesGating").shouldShowOptimisticPreviews()&&a.id==="m-stories-owner-bucket"&&i&&(d=i.getURI(a));if(d){c=new(h||(h=b("URI")))(d);c=c.getQueryData();var e=c.tray_session_id;new(b("WebFunnelLogger"))("FBStoriesMTouchTrayViewerFunnelDefinition").addFunnelPayload("tray_index",c.selected_bucket_index).setSessionKey((c=e)!=null?c:"null").setAction("Tray item select").log();this._setLoadingStateHidden(a,!1);window.setTimeout(function(){b("MPageController").load(d,{hideLoadingIndicator:!0});var a=b("Stratcom").listen("m:page:iui:response:complete",null,function(c){c=c.getData()||{};c=c.path;if(c==null||!c.includes("stories/view_tray"))return;new(b("WebFunnelLogger"))("FBStoriesMTouchTrayViewerFunnelDefinition").setSessionKey((c=e)!=null?c:"null").setAction("Viewer rendered").markEnd().log();a.remove()})},b("MStoriesTrayUIConstants").REDIRECT_DELAY_IN_MS)}},_destroy:function(){var a=b("MStoriesProductionTrayUtils").getAnimationPog();a&&b("CSS").removeClass(a,b("MStoriesProductionTrayUtils").getUploadingClass());this._listeners.forEach(function(a){return a.remove()});this._listeners=[]}};e.exports=a}),null); __d("MStoriesUtils",["cx","fbt","DOM","MPageController","MStoriesStratcomEvents","MStoriesUIConstants","Stratcom","Style","gkx","goURI"],(function(a,b,c,d,e,f,g,h){"use strict";__p&&__p();var i={UNSET:"UNSET",PUBLIC:"PUBLIC",FRIENDS_AND_CONNECTIONS:"FRIENDS_AND_CONNECTIONS",FRIENDS:"FRIENDS",CUSTOM:"CUSTOM"},j=[],k={getDocumentScale:function(){var a=window.visualViewport;return a?a.scale:document.body?document.body.clientWidth/window.innerWidth:1},listenForThreadTransition:function(a){var c,d;c=[(c=b("Stratcom")).listen("click","m-stories-next-button",a),c.listen("click","m-stories-prev-button",a),c.listen((d=b("MStoriesStratcomEvents")).CARD_CHANGED_BY_VIEWER_SHEET,null,a),c.listen(d.NEXT_CARD,null,a),c.listen(d.NEXT_BUCKET,null,a),c.listen(d.PREV_BUCKET,null,a)];return c},iOSVersion:function(){if(/iP(hone|od|ad)/.test(navigator.platform)){var a=navigator.appVersion.match(/OS (\d+)_(\d+)_?(\d+)?/);return a==null?null:parseInt(a[1],10)}return null},goBackToHomepage:function(){if(j.length>0){b("MPageController").load(j.pop(),{expiration:b("MStoriesUIConstants").REFRESH_TIMEOUT_IN_MS});return}var a=document.getElementsByClassName("_129-")[0],c=this.iOSVersion();c=c&&c<10;!c&&(a||b("gkx")("709647"))?(b("DOM").show(a),b("MPageController").load("/",{expiration:b("MStoriesUIConstants").REFRESH_TIMEOUT_IN_MS})):b("goURI")("/")},getCropInfo:function(a,b,c,d,e){__p&&__p();var f={sx:0,sy:0,sWidth:a,sHeight:b,dWidth:c,dHeight:d};if(!e){e=a/b;e=c/e;e<=d?f.dHeight=e:(f.sy=(e-d)/2*(b/e),f.sHeight=b-f.sy*2)}else{e=c/b*a;e<=d?f.dHeight=e:(f.sx=(e-d)/2*(a/d),f.sWidth=a-f.sx*2)}return f},getAudienceModeHeaderMapping:function(a){switch(a){case i.PUBLIC:return h._("Public");case i.FRIENDS_AND_CONNECTIONS:return h._("Friends and Connections");case i.FRIENDS:return h._("Friends");case i.CUSTOM:return h._("Custom");default:return h._("Unset")}},touchMoveListener:function(a){a.touches.length===1&&k.getDocumentScale()===1&&a.preventDefault()},truncateParagraphToFitContainer:function(a){__p&&__p();var c=a.textContent,d=!1;do{var e=b("Style").get(a,"max-height");b("Style").set(a,"max-height","unset");var f=a.clientHeight;b("Style").set(a,"maxHeight",e);e=a.clientHeight;if(f<=e){d=!0;break}c=c.slice(0,-1);a.textContent=c+"..."}while(!d)},setExitUri:function(a,b){b===void 0&&(b=!1);if(a==null)return;b?j.push(a):j=[a]},getInnerText:function(a){var b="",c=!0;for(var d=0;da&&this._showCTA();this._ctaVisible&&b("MViewport").getScrollTop()